Italian Man Sentenced To 24 Years In Prison For Killing A Nigerian

An Italian court has sentenced one Filippo Ferlazzo, Italian, to 24 years in prison for beating a Nigerian, Alika Ogorchukwu, to death. Ferlazzo, committed the murder on July 30, 2022, at Marche Region, Italy, as confirmed at the time by the Nigerian Embassy, Rome, Italy. Ogorchukwu who was physically challenged, sources say, was hawking wares…

Twin Sisters Hack Brother To Death Over Piece Of Land

By Emma Una The Police in Calabar have arrested twin sisters for allegedly butchering their elder brother to death with machetes, for selling their late father’s land and refusing to share the proceeds with them. The twins, identified as Ikwo Effiong and Idak Effiong, allegedly took the life of their elder brother, Kokoette Effiong, for…

30-Year Old Mother Of One Killed In Ugep

A 30-year old mother of one, Miracle Eteng Okoi, has been killed in Ugep, Yakurr Local Government Area, CRS, in circumstances suspected to be a ritual killing. Sources in Ugep, Yakurr LGA, Cross River Central, say the victim, who went missing in fuzzy circumstances last Wednesday morning, was found 48 hours after, buried in a…
